新聞中心
Oracle 10監(jiān)聽開啟讓操作更便捷

成都創(chuàng)新互聯(lián)公司服務項目包括介休網(wǎng)站建設、介休網(wǎng)站制作、介休網(wǎng)頁制作以及介休網(wǎng)絡營銷策劃等。多年來,我們專注于互聯(lián)網(wǎng)行業(yè),利用自身積累的技術優(yōu)勢、行業(yè)經(jīng)驗、深度合作伙伴關系等,向廣大中小型企業(yè)、政府機構等提供互聯(lián)網(wǎng)行業(yè)的解決方案,介休網(wǎng)站推廣取得了明顯的社會效益與經(jīng)濟效益。目前,我們服務的客戶以成都為中心已經(jīng)輻射到介休省份的部分城市,未來相信會繼續(xù)擴大服務區(qū)域并繼續(xù)獲得客戶的支持與信任!
在數(shù)據(jù)庫管理和維護過程中,確保Oracle監(jiān)聽服務(Listener)處于運行狀態(tài)至關重要,監(jiān)聽器是Oracle數(shù)據(jù)庫實例與客戶端應用程序之間的通信媒介,它負責處理來自客戶端的連接請求,并將這些請求路由到正確的服務和實例,對于使用Oracle 10g版本數(shù)據(jù)庫的用戶來說,了解如何有效地開啟和配置監(jiān)聽器,不僅能提升數(shù)據(jù)庫的訪問效率,還能簡化日常的運維工作,以下是關于如何開啟并優(yōu)化Oracle 10監(jiān)聽服務的詳細技術指導。
監(jiān)聽器的作用及重要性
監(jiān)聽器作為數(shù)據(jù)庫的一個關鍵組件,其基本職責是接受客戶端的連接請求,當一個用戶嘗試連接到Oracle數(shù)據(jù)庫時,監(jiān)聽器會驗證請求的有效性,然后根據(jù)配置將用戶導向?qū)臄?shù)據(jù)庫實例,沒有監(jiān)聽器的數(shù)據(jù)庫系統(tǒng)無法被遠程客戶端訪問,因此保證監(jiān)聽器的正確配置和持續(xù)運行對數(shù)據(jù)庫的正常操作至關重要。
Oracle 10監(jiān)聽開啟步驟
要開啟Oracle 10的監(jiān)聽服務,可以遵循以下步驟:
1、確認監(jiān)聽器的狀態(tài)
在命令行界面中,輸入lsnrctl status命令來檢查監(jiān)聽器是否正在運行,如果監(jiān)聽器未運行,此命令還將顯示監(jiān)聽器配置文件的位置。
2、編輯監(jiān)聽器配置文件
監(jiān)聽器的主要配置文件通常是listener.ora,位于$ORACLE_HOME/network/admin目錄下,使用文本編輯器打開該文件,并根據(jù)需求進行配置修改。
3、啟動監(jiān)聽器服務
返回命令行界面,輸入lsnrctl start命令以啟動監(jiān)聽器,如果需要監(jiān)聽器隨系統(tǒng)啟動而自動運行,可以使用lsnrctl start命令加上參數(shù)startup來實現(xiàn)。
4、驗證監(jiān)聽器狀態(tài)
再次使用lsnrctl status命令來確認監(jiān)聽器是否已經(jīng)成功啟動,并檢查是否有錯誤信息。
常見配置項說明
在listener.ora文件中,有幾個關鍵配置項需要注意:
HOST:指定監(jiān)聽器所綁定的主機名或IP地址。
PORT:設置監(jiān)聽器監(jiān)聽的端口號,Oracle默認端口為1521。
SERVICE_NAME:定義數(shù)據(jù)庫服務名稱,這是客戶端連接時需要指定的服務名。
SID_DESC:描述數(shù)據(jù)庫實例的系統(tǒng)標識符(SID),用于將服務名映射到具體的數(shù)據(jù)庫實例。
監(jiān)聽器的配置優(yōu)化
為了提高性能和可靠性,可以考慮以下優(yōu)化措施:
啟用日志記錄功能,通過設置TRACE_LEVEL參數(shù)來監(jiān)控和調(diào)試監(jiān)聽器的行為。
調(diào)整PROCESSES參數(shù)以控制監(jiān)聽器可以創(chuàng)建的最大并發(fā)處理進程數(shù)。
使用BACKLOG參數(shù)來增加監(jiān)聽器隊列中等待處理的連接請求的數(shù)量。
針對多CPU系統(tǒng),設置THREADS參數(shù)以允許多個線程同時處理傳入的連接請求。
故障排除與維護
在日常運維過程中,可能會遇到監(jiān)聽器故障的情況,這時,可以通過以下方法進行問題定位和解決:
檢查日志文件,通常位于$ORACLE_BASE/diagnostics/tnslsnr/主機名/listener/trace目錄下,以獲取詳細的錯誤信息。
使用lsnrctl stop和lsnrctl start命令重啟監(jiān)聽器。
如果問題依然存在,可以嘗試重新生成監(jiān)聽器配置文件,使用lsnrctl reload命令加載最新的配置。
安全考慮
確保監(jiān)聽器的安全同樣重要,應該采取以下措施保護監(jiān)聽器:
限制監(jiān)聽器可接受連接的IP地址范圍。
使用強密碼策略保護數(shù)據(jù)庫賬戶。
定期更新Oracle軟件,修補已知的安全漏洞。
Oracle 10的監(jiān)聽服務是數(shù)據(jù)庫與客戶端通信的橋梁,它的正確配置和高效運行對于數(shù)據(jù)庫的性能和穩(wěn)定性至關重要,通過上述步驟和最佳實踐,管理員可以確保監(jiān)聽器的順暢運行,從而讓數(shù)據(jù)庫操作更加便捷和安全。
名稱欄目:Oracle10監(jiān)聽開啟讓操作更便捷
分享地址:http://www.dlmjj.cn/article/ccediei.html


咨詢
建站咨詢
